The Biochemistry of AGEs and Metabolic Sabotage
AGEs damage collagen and elastin in blood vessels, promoting hypertension and reduced nutrient delivery to muscles. More critically, they activate the RAGE receptor, flooding cells with oxidative stress and inflammatory cytokines. This directly impairs mitochondrial function, reducing the cell’s ability to burn fat for fuel.
In individuals with hyperinsulinemia, the combination is particularly toxic. High insulin already promotes fat storage; AGEs compound the problem by worsening insulin resistance at the cellular level. Studies demonstrate that diets high in dietary AGEs increase HOMA-IR scores independently of total calories. This explains why some people following strict CICO still plateau— their metabolic machinery is inflamed and glycated.
Visceral adiposity further amplifies the cycle. Abdominal fat cells release more free fatty acids into the portal vein, driving hepatic inflammation that accelerates endogenous AGE formation. The result is a self-reinforcing loop of rising A1C, elevated CRP, and progressive metabolic inflexibility.
How Modern Foods Create an AGE Overload
The modern diet is engineered for high AGE production. High-fructose corn syrup accelerates glycation in the liver, while amylopectin A in modern wheat causes rapid glucose spikes that promote both endogenous and dietary AGEs. Ultra-processed snacks, fried foods, and grilled meats cooked above 300°F (especially without marinades) deliver massive dietary AGE loads.
Even “healthy” choices can backfire. Dry roasting nuts, browning butter, or using high-heat oils generates significant AGEs. Meanwhile, low-fiber diets starve beneficial gut bacteria such as Akkermansia muciniphila, which normally help neutralize inflammatory signals triggered by AGEs. The resulting dysbiosis increases intestinal permeability, allowing AGEs and bacterial toxins to enter circulation and further inflame metabolic tissues.
Research comparing ancestral complex carbohydrates (properly prepared tubers, soaked legumes, and whole grains) versus refined flours shows markedly lower postprandial AGE formation and improved gut microbiome diversity with the former. This underscores why simply counting calories without considering food quality often fails.

Practical Strategies to Lower AGEs and Restore Metabolic Freedom
Effective AGE management combines dietary mastery, lifestyle tools, and strategic supplementation. Prioritize moist cooking methods (steaming, poaching, slow-cooking) over grilling or frying. Use acidic marinades (lemon, vinegar) to cut AGE formation by up to 50%. Choose ancestral complex carbohydrates prepared traditionally to minimize glycemic load and feed beneficial microbes.
Support gut microbiome repair during off-cycles with 30+ plant foods weekly, targeted prebiotics (inulin, partially hydrolyzed guar gum), and polyphenol-rich extracts that selectively nourish Akkermansia.
